Diptayan outplays Sayantan

Staff Reporter Published 06.12.11, 12:00 AM

Calcutta: Diptayan Ghosh of South Point beat Sayantan Das of Scottish Church Collegiate School in the 23rd The Telegraph Schools’ Chess Championship at the Gorky Sadan, on Monday.

The meet is sponsored by Himani Sona Chandi Chyawanprash, in association with NIIT (nguru), and is organised by Alekhine Chess Club.

Diptayan, Sayantan, Suvankar Maity and Subhradipta are in a four-way lead with eight points each.

Diptayan employed Catalan Opening but black went for a sort of Dutch formation. Diptayan slowly outplayed his opponent and finally Sayantan, who even tried for a piece sacrifice to obtain a draw, resigned on 40th move.

The day saw two upsets. Chandrasish Majumder of St Xavier’s was defeated by Suvankar Maity of Behala Asya Bidyamandir. Chandrasish took several risks but Suvankar (1823) kept his cool and avoided all pitfalls and eked out a win in 48 moves.

Abhrapratim Manna of Don Bosco, Park Circus, lost to Subhradipta Das of Aditya Academy, Dum Dum. In a better position, Abhrapratim made a blunder and lost the game.

Kumar Sanu of DPS, Dhanbad, drew with Kaustav Kundu of South Point. White had a better position throughout but black somehow managed to hold the balance.
